I went to North Texas State, where McMurtry was the big deal alum among the English teachers. He's written a lot of great stuff: "Lonesome Dove," "Last Picture Show," "Terms of Endearment," and more. Of course, he's also written a lot of hard-to-get-through wanking. As a general rule, his western stuff is better than his contemporary stuff (aside from "Terms"), and his sequels aren't as good as his originals. If you loved "Lonesome Dove," avoid "Streets of Laredo" and preserve the memory.
